In a folding roof for an automobile, a front hood bar is moved by entraining elements driven by cables, which entraining elements can travel in curved transitions of lateral guide rails and simultaneously in curved control slits of control plates, slidable transversely on the front hood bar. The control slits run partly ascending towards the closure position, in order to create a downward displacement of the front hood bar as the roof is closed and an upward displacement of the hood bar as the roof is opened. The closing of the roof takes place with a continually decreasing speed of movement and continually increasing closure force, without any noticeable feedback effect upon the actuating force to be applied. |
